Abstract
A plurality of heat transfer fins are arranged so as to surround straight pipe portions of heat transfer tubes connected through bends in a serpentine arrangement. Heat transfer surfaces for transferring heat between air of the heat transfer tubes and the heat transfer fins have holes each having a radius smaller than the critical radius of a nucleus that occurs upon phase change from water vapor to condensed water droplets such that the holes are filled with the air at all times. Water is allowed to move from the holes filled with the air having low surface energy to metal part having high surface energy, thus improving drainage.
